FERMENTASI BIOETANOL DARI BATANG PISANG BATU (MUSA BALBISIANA) PRAPERLAKUAN KOH MICROWAVE DAN PEMODELAN KINETIKA

Uljanah, Dhika - Personal Name;

Banana pseudostem waste was minimally utilized and often discarded by the community. However, many studies found that banana pseudostems could be fermented to produce bioethanol due to its high cellulose content. Therefore, this study conducted bioethanol fermentation from banana pseudostems waste (Musa balbisiana) pretreated with KOH microwave by separate hydrolysis and fermentation. The effect of yeast concentrations (8, 10, and 12%) and fermentation times (6, 7, 8, 12, and 13 days) on pretreated banana pseudostems waste was analyzed. The fermentation applied enzymatic kinetic modeling using Michaelis-Menten's equations to determine the reaction rate. The result showed that the sample with 12% yeast and fermentation time in 13 days produced the highest ethanol content. The appropriate kinetic modeling result was similar to Hanes Woolf's linearization modeling with variations of the 10% yeast concentrations, resulting in KM values of 160,65 x 10-5 g mL-1 and Vmax of 68,37 x 10-5 g mL-1 h with regression 0,99.
